Lorsque vous enregistrez la clé publique auprès d’Auth0, vous devez fournir la clé publique encodée au format PEM. Vous pouvez la fournir sous la forme d’un certificat X.509 encodé au format PEM. Auth0 impose une taille de clé RSA minimale de 2048 bits et une taille de clé maximale de 4096 bits. Nous recommandons d’utiliser OpenSSL pour générer une paire de clés RSA de 2048 bits.Documentation Index
Fetch the complete documentation index at: https://docs-staging.auth0-mintlify.app/llms.txt
Use this file to discover all available pages before exploring further.
- Générez une clé privée et une clé publique en PEM. Vous devez protéger la clé privée et ne jamais la partager, même avec Auth0 :
openssl genrsa -out test_key.pem 2048
- Extrayez la clé publique au format PEM à l’aide de la commande suivante. Cette commande extrait les détails de la clé publique afin qu’elle puisse être partagée en toute sécurité sans révéler les détails de la clé privée :
openssl rsa -in test_key.pem -outform PEM -pubout -out test_key.pem.pub
L’exemple ci-dessous montre le contenu du fichier PEM test_key.pem.pub :
- Enregistrez le fichier PEM. Vous aurez besoin du contenu de la clé dans d’autres étapes de configuration de l’application.